Čoaffi
Čoaffi is a hill in Kåfjord Municipality, Troms and has an elevation of 494 metres. Čoaffi is situated nearby to the locality Vatnet, as well as near the village Fossen.Places of Interest

Museum for Northern Peoples
Public building
The Museum for Northern Peoples is a museum located at the Center for Northern Peoples in Manndalen in Gáivuotna Municipality in Troms county, Norway. It covers the art and culture of northern peoples, and regional Sami culture and history.
